首页 常识文章正文

集群和负载均衡的区别,让技术变得像家常便饭

常识 2025年03月25日 12:03 17 美荃

想象一下,你正在一个繁忙的餐厅里,顾客络绎不绝,而厨房里的厨师们正忙得不可开交,这时,餐厅经理决定采取一些措施来提高效率,让顾客的等待时间减少,同时确保食物的质量和速度,这个场景其实和我们在计算机世界中遇到的“集群”和“负载均衡”非常相似,这两者究竟有什么区别呢?让我们来一探究竟。

集群:团队合作的力量

让我们来聊聊集群,集群就像是一群厨师在厨房里共同工作,他们每个人都有自己的专长,比如有人擅长做披萨,有人擅长做意大利面,当餐厅接到大量订单时,他们不是单打独斗,而是通过团队合作来完成这些订单,这就是集群的核心思想:多个计算机(或节点)协同工作,共同处理任务,以提高整体的处理能力和可靠性。

想象一下,如果一个厨师突然生病了,其他的厨师可以接手他的工作,这样顾客就不会因为等待时间过长而感到不满,同样,在计算机集群中,如果一个节点出现问题,其他节点可以接管它的任务,保证服务的连续性。

集群和负载均衡的区别,让技术变得像家常便饭

负载均衡:聪明的调度员

让我们转向负载均衡,这就像是餐厅里的调度员,他的工作是确保每个厨师的工作量都是平均的,没有人被过度劳累,也没有人闲着没事干,在计算机世界中,负载均衡器就像是那个调度员,它负责将进入的请求(顾客的订单)分配给不同的服务器(厨师),以确保每个服务器都不会过载。

想象一下,如果所有的订单都堆在一个厨师那里,他可能会因为压力过大而出错,或者效率降低,负载均衡器就是为了避免这种情况,它确保每个服务器都有足够的工作量,但不会超出其处理能力。

集群与负载均衡的结合:完美的厨房运作

在实际应用中,集群和负载均衡往往是结合使用的,这就像是餐厅里的厨师团队和调度员的合作,厨师团队(集群)负责处理订单,而调度员(负载均衡器)确保这些订单被合理分配。

一个在线购物网站可能会使用集群来处理大量的用户请求,同时使用负载均衡器来确保这些请求被均匀地分配到不同的服务器上,这样,即使在高峰时段,网站也能保持快速响应,用户不会遇到页面加载缓慢或服务不可用的问题。

应用场景和潜在影响

集群和负载均衡的应用场景非常广泛,从大型企业的数据存储和处理,到小型网站的用户体验优化,它们的主要影响包括:

  1. 提高可用性:通过集群,即使部分节点出现问题,服务也能继续运行。
  2. 增强扩展性:随着业务的增长,可以简单地增加更多的节点来处理更多的请求。
  3. 优化性能:负载均衡确保每个服务器都以最佳效率运行,避免瓶颈。
  4. 降低成本:通过合理分配任务,可以减少对高性能硬件的依赖,从而降低成本。

通过这个比喻,我们可以看到集群和负载均衡在计算机世界中的重要性,它们就像是餐厅里的厨师团队和调度员,共同确保顾客(用户)得到快速、高质量的服务,理解这两者的区别,可以帮助我们更好地设计和优化我们的系统,以应对不断变化的需求和挑战。

大金科技网  网站地图 免责声明:本网站部分内容由用户自行上传,若侵犯了您的权益,请联系我们处理,谢谢!联系QQ:2760375052 沪ICP备2023024866号-3